Assistant Coach, Track Multi Events (Creative Design)



Position Summary: The Track & Field coach is responsible for all aspects of training and coaching student-athletes with an emphasis on the multi-events, decathlon & heptathlon.  

Position Responsibilities:

  • Prepares a Track & Field training program for all student-athletes who participate in the multi-events, decathlon & heptathlon.
  • Assesses the skill development of each student-athlete, and partners with school staff and performance coaches to ensure their ongoing comprehensive development
  • Assists with the psychological preparation of the student-athlete in both pre-game and post-game
  • Develops motivational approach to practices and games
  • Interacts with the student-athlete as a mentor and as an educator of the sport
  • Responsible for delivering a high-quality program that aids in the annual retention of student-athletes
  • Assists in the college placement of the student-athlete
  • Supports and maintains a high level of understanding of the four-year model for the Academy program student-athlete
  • Effectively communicates to student-athletes and their parents/guardians
  • Partners with the student-athlete's parent/guardian regarding their overall development
  • Assists sport advisors in generating new leads and maintaining an accurate pipeline for enrollments
  • Assures that proper safety is maintained
  • Travels to tournaments and other events as needed
  • Coaches at Track & Field camps held at IMG Academy
  • Adheres to all company policies, procedures and business ethic codes
  • Performs other duties as assigned

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:

  • Experience in coaching and/or competing in Track & Field at the professional and/or collegiate level
  • Bachelor's degree in an appropriate field
  • Proficiency in all Track & Field training and instructional techniques with an emphasis on the multi-events
  • Strong commitment to student-athletes and their development academically, athletically, and socially
  • Desire to work collaboratively with colleagues 
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Commitment to comprehensive excellence 

Preferred Skills:

  • Bilingual
  • USA Track and Field certification and/or IAAF certification in the Multi-Events
  • CPR Certification
  • Valid driver's license with ability to drive for tournaments, games, travel 

Physical Demands and Work Environment:

  • Ability to lift, move, push and pull equipment in excess of 40 pounds
  • Ability to handle outdoor conditions for a reasonable period of time
  • Ability to move around campus including gym, track and field stadium etc.
  • Ability to work flexible hours to include nights, weekends and holidays
